Kommentar
Åtkomst till den här sidan kräver auktorisering. Du kan prova att logga in eller ändra kataloger.
Åtkomst till den här sidan kräver auktorisering. Du kan prova att ändra kataloger.
Definierar en strömmande DataFrame i en tabell. Datakällan som motsvarar tabellen måste ha stöd för strömningsläge.
Syntax
table(tableName)
Parameters
| Parameter | Type | Beskrivning |
|---|---|---|
tableName |
str | Tabellens namn. |
Retur
DataFrame
Exempel
Läs in en dataström från en tabell:
import tempfile
import time
_ = spark.sql("DROP TABLE IF EXISTS my_table")
with tempfile.TemporaryDirectory(prefix="table") as d:
q1 = spark.readStream.format("rate").load().writeStream.toTable(
"my_table", checkpointLocation=d)
q2 = spark.readStream.table("my_table").writeStream.format("console").start()
time.sleep(3)
q1.stop()
q2.stop()
_ = spark.sql("DROP TABLE my_table")